CMS Athletics Primed for
D-III Championships This Week

The spring sport season for the NCAA Division III Championships has begun and CMS is involved in multiple championships. CMS will host competitions in women's lacrosse and men's tennis this week while softball will travel to Iowa to compete and one individual began play today at the men's golf championships.
The women's lacrosse team (15-2), which recently won the inaugural SCIAC Championship, will host Endicott College (16-4) in a first-round game at 3 p.m. on Wednesday, May 12. This game marks only the second time that an NCAA tournament lacrosse game has been played in the state of California. The game will take place on Pomona College's soccer field. The winner of this game will play the winner of the Cabrini College at College of New Jersey game at 2:30 p.m. (Eastern) on Saturday, May 15 in Salisbury, Md.
The men's tennis team will host second- and third-round matches Thursday through Friday, May 13-14, at the Biszantz Family Tennis Center. The Stags (20-5), ranked third nationally and No. 1 in the West Region, will face Whitman College (20-4), ranked No. 22 nationally and No. 6 in the West, at 11 a.m. In the other match, Cal Lutheran (19-2), ranked No. 4 nationally and No. 2 in the West, takes on UC Santa Cruz (14-7), ranked No. 6 nationally and No. 3 in the West, at 2 p.m. The winners will play at 1 p.m. on Friday, with the victors advancing to the NCAA Team Championships in Oberlin, Ohio, on May 25.
On the first day of the men's golf championships in Hershey, Penn., CMC sophomore Tain Lee shot a two-under 69 to take the clubhouse lead with additional players still on the course. Lee, the SCIAC Player of the Year (http://www.cmsathletics.org/sports/spring/mgolf/2009-10/news/0406aow), is competing in the championships as an individual for the second straight year. After a school record 33 regular season wins, the softball team was selected for the 60-team NCAA Championship field for the second consecutive season on Monday. CMS (33-8) will open the double-elimination regional against Central College (30-12) at 2 p.m. (Central) on Thursday, May 13. The regional is being hosted by Simpson College in Indianola, IA.
CMS, the fourth seed in the eight-team regional, will face either top-seeded Linfield College (35-5) or eighth-seeded University of Chicago (24-13-1) on Friday, at either noon or 4 p.m., depending on the results of the Thursday games. Additional games on Friday, Saturday, Sunday, and Monday are possible depending on the results of the Thursday and Friday games.
